There were fewer lifeless fish on the riverbed now, and the first signs of the living, dying, and desperate.<\/p>\n<p>I saw trout with clouded eyes, their bodies veiled in a milky-grey film. Some floated upside down near the surface, barely moving. Others rose from the bottom in spasms of effort, only to sink back down again, spent.<\/p>\n<p>These once beautiful creatures should have been freckled with vibrant red spots against sleek, silvery-brown bodies. They should have been darting through the current with speed, agility, and grace.<\/p>\n<p>Instead, I watched their sickness, their distress, their final moments. Grief weighed on me. Anger too at what was, almost certainly, the work of human negligence.<\/p>\n","protected":false},"excerpt":{"rendered":"<p>As I headed upstream from Lover\u2019s Leap toward the River Blackwater Beach, I noticed a change.
